Output 166659ebc723ea2b685bba02f7de1030d9f76849703c38e12b593880ad59e556:0

value
67292851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 040d8d2d3f24db65e4217f6f377441d1f195e01a OP_EQUALVERIFY OP_CHECKSIG
address
1NRwLj2abe9cLujAR9iqoTaUQKhpL5x8G
transaction
166659ebc723ea2b685bba02f7de1030d9f76849703c38e12b593880ad59e556
spent
true